|
|
|
@ -105,48 +105,48 @@ |
|
|
|
<build> |
|
|
|
<finalName>${project.artifactId}</finalName> |
|
|
|
<plugins> |
|
|
|
<!-- <plugin>--> |
|
|
|
<!-- <groupId>org.apache.maven.plugins</groupId>--> |
|
|
|
<!-- <artifactId>maven-compiler-plugin</artifactId>--> |
|
|
|
<!-- <version>3.8.1</version>--> |
|
|
|
<!-- <configuration>--> |
|
|
|
<!-- <source>1.8</source>--> |
|
|
|
<!-- <target>1.8</target>--> |
|
|
|
<!-- <encoding>UTF-8</encoding>--> |
|
|
|
<!-- </configuration>--> |
|
|
|
<!-- </plugin>--> |
|
|
|
<plugin> |
|
|
|
<groupId>com.github.wvengen</groupId> |
|
|
|
<artifactId>proguard-maven-plugin</artifactId> |
|
|
|
<version>2.3.1</version> |
|
|
|
<executions> |
|
|
|
<execution> |
|
|
|
<phase>package</phase> |
|
|
|
<goals> |
|
|
|
<goal>proguard</goal> |
|
|
|
</goals> |
|
|
|
</execution> |
|
|
|
</executions> |
|
|
|
<groupId>org.apache.maven.plugins</groupId> |
|
|
|
<artifactId>maven-compiler-plugin</artifactId> |
|
|
|
<version>3.8.1</version> |
|
|
|
<configuration> |
|
|
|
<proguardVersion>6.0.3</proguardVersion> |
|
|
|
<injar>${project.build.finalName}.jar</injar> |
|
|
|
<outjar>${project.build.finalName}.jar</outjar> |
|
|
|
<obfuscate>true</obfuscate> |
|
|
|
<proguardInclude>${project.basedir}/proguard.cfg</proguardInclude> |
|
|
|
<libs> |
|
|
|
<lib>${java.home}/lib/rt.jar</lib> |
|
|
|
<lib>${java.home}/lib/jce.jar</lib> |
|
|
|
<lib>${java.home}/lib/jsse.jar</lib> |
|
|
|
</libs> |
|
|
|
<source>1.8</source> |
|
|
|
<target>1.8</target> |
|
|
|
<encoding>UTF-8</encoding> |
|
|
|
</configuration> |
|
|
|
<dependencies> |
|
|
|
<dependency> |
|
|
|
<groupId>net.sf.proguard</groupId> |
|
|
|
<artifactId>proguard-base</artifactId> |
|
|
|
<version>6.0.3</version> |
|
|
|
</dependency> |
|
|
|
</dependencies> |
|
|
|
</plugin> |
|
|
|
<!-- <plugin>--> |
|
|
|
<!-- <groupId>com.github.wvengen</groupId>--> |
|
|
|
<!-- <artifactId>proguard-maven-plugin</artifactId>--> |
|
|
|
<!-- <version>2.3.1</version>--> |
|
|
|
<!-- <executions>--> |
|
|
|
<!-- <execution>--> |
|
|
|
<!-- <phase>package</phase>--> |
|
|
|
<!-- <goals>--> |
|
|
|
<!-- <goal>proguard</goal>--> |
|
|
|
<!-- </goals>--> |
|
|
|
<!-- </execution>--> |
|
|
|
<!-- </executions>--> |
|
|
|
<!-- <configuration>--> |
|
|
|
<!-- <proguardVersion>6.0.3</proguardVersion>--> |
|
|
|
<!-- <injar>${project.build.finalName}.jar</injar>--> |
|
|
|
<!-- <outjar>${project.build.finalName}.jar</outjar>--> |
|
|
|
<!-- <obfuscate>true</obfuscate>--> |
|
|
|
<!-- <proguardInclude>${project.basedir}/proguard.cfg</proguardInclude>--> |
|
|
|
<!-- <libs>--> |
|
|
|
<!-- <lib>${java.home}/lib/rt.jar</lib>--> |
|
|
|
<!-- <lib>${java.home}/lib/jce.jar</lib>--> |
|
|
|
<!-- <lib>${java.home}/lib/jsse.jar</lib>--> |
|
|
|
<!-- </libs>--> |
|
|
|
<!-- </configuration>--> |
|
|
|
<!-- <dependencies>--> |
|
|
|
<!-- <dependency>--> |
|
|
|
<!-- <groupId>net.sf.proguard</groupId>--> |
|
|
|
<!-- <artifactId>proguard-base</artifactId>--> |
|
|
|
<!-- <version>6.0.3</version>--> |
|
|
|
<!-- </dependency>--> |
|
|
|
<!-- </dependencies>--> |
|
|
|
<!-- </plugin>--> |
|
|
|
<plugin> |
|
|
|
<groupId>org.springframework.boot</groupId> |
|
|
|
<artifactId>spring-boot-maven-plugin</artifactId> |
|
|
|
|